Associated space launch

YAOGAN 16B was lifted into orbit during the mission ‘Long March 4C | Yaogan 16A, Yaogan 16B, Yaogan 16C’, on board a Long March 4C space rocket.

The launch took place on Nov. 25, 2012, 4:06 a.m. from Launch Area 94 (SLS-2 / 603).
